Подскажите пожалуйста что означает запись:
DynamicArray< DynamicArray< long double > > А_mas;
Здравствуйте, Аноним, Вы писали:
А>А>DynamicArray< DynamicArray< long double > > А_mas;
А>
Динамический массив динамических массивов чисел с плавающей точкой.
Здравствуйте, Владик, Вы писали:
В>Здравствуйте, Аноним, Вы писали:
А>>А>>DynamicArray< DynamicArray< long double > > А_mas;
А>>
В>Динамический массив динамических массивов чисел с плавающей точкой.
Можно ли это заменить на следующее:
stl::vector< vector <long double> > A_mas;
Здравствуйте, Аноним, Вы писали:
А>А>stl::vector< vector <long double> > A_mas;
А>
Если не нужна совместимость с дельфями — то можно и нужно.
А вот что бутед являться аналогами (для VECTOR) следующих операций приминяемых в работе с
DynamicArray< DynamicArray<int> > mas;
mas.Length = 10;
mas[1].Length = 10; и нужно.
Здравствуйте, Аноним, Вы писали:
А>mas.Length = 10;
А>mas[1].Length = 10; и нужно.
mas.resize(10);
mas[0].resize(10);
По чему то БИЛДЕРОВСКИЙ
DEBAG WINDOW не хочет значения показывать записанных в массив VECTOR...
std::vector < std::vector< int > > matrix;
matrix.resize(10);
for(i=0; i<10; i++)
matrix[i].resize(10);
Зписываю туда значения
matrix[0][0] = 100;
т вывожу в DEGUG WINDOW (Буилдера)
matrix[0][0]: E2382 Side effects are not allowed
Можно ли как то под отладкой значения просмотреть?!